AAY to SAH: Distance and Flight Time
The distance from Al Ghaydah International Airport (AAY) to Sanaa International Airport (SAH) is 855 km (531 mi). A typical nonstop flight covers it in about 1h 35m, heading west. The distance is the same in either direction (SAH to AAY).
How far is it from Al Ghaydah to Sanaa?
The great-circle distance between Al Ghaydah International Airport (AAY) and Sanaa International Airport (SAH) is 855 km (531 mi, 461 nautical miles). That is the straight-line distance; a real flight is a little longer because of air-traffic routing.
How long is the flight from AAY to SAH?
A nonstop flight typically takes about 1h 35m. This is an estimate from the distance; actual block times depend on the aircraft, winds and the exact routing. SAH is roughly west of AAY.
